Welcome to DevOpsKit by Deep Singh. This project is designed to help you easily install various DevOps tools on your Ubuntu machine.
- Easy installation of popular DevOps tools
- Clear and colorful command line interface
- Robust error handling for smooth installation
Before you start, ensure you have the following:
- An Ubuntu machine
- Root privileges to install software
- Network connectivity
- 
Clone the repository: https://github.com/dipu-devops/DevOpsKit.git cd DevOpsKit
- 
Run the installation script: chmod +x install.sh bash install.sh or sudo ./install
- 
Follow the prompts to select and install the desired tool.

If you encounter any issues, here are some common solutions:
- Ensure you have root privileges: Run the script with sudoif necessary.
- Check your network connection: Make sure your machine is connected to the internet.
- Verify sufficient disk space: Ensure at least 1GB of free space is available.
